Output d12eba4fe8715971ce189770f37ce61d10de9a85d94b863c8440d401d27384a9:8

value
499783
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aeb20eddb686e43a85f2e2d4a7bb98e612b7d957 OP_EQUAL
address
3HciocZM76iPMJdm7Uhye1pAaR776UEgza
transaction
d12eba4fe8715971ce189770f37ce61d10de9a85d94b863c8440d401d27384a9
spent
true